Dumfries spent much of the season sidelined, from late November to early March, recovering from ankle surgery. Despite his absence, Inter dominated the domestic campaign. He still provided an assist in the 2-0 cup final win over Lazio. That assist helped the Nerazzurri secure a domestic double.

To replace him, Inter are pursuing Marco Palestra, though the Atalanta right-back—currently on loan at Cagliari—is expected to cost at least €50m.

At Real Madrid, Dumfries will challenge Trent Alexander-Arnold for the right-back berth after club icon Dani Carvajal departed. The 27-year-old, who joined on a free transfer from Liverpool last summer, made little impact in his debut season, hampered by two lengthy muscle injuries. To cap a frustrating campaign, he was left out of England's World Cup squad by manager Thomas Tuchel.
